Аннотация:Transition and rare earth metal fluorides (CoF3, K2NiF6, TbF4 and CeF4) art, widely used as solid fluorinating agents. Their thermal decomposition leads to the release of gaseous fluorine. Knudsen cell mass spectrometry has been applied to investigate thermal decomposition of aforementioned fluorinating agents. The characteristic working interval of temperatures and composition of the gas phase for each compound have been determined. According to our findings, fluorine is released both in atomic and molecular forms. F is the main component of the gas phase during TbF4 and K2NiF6 decomposition, which can be used as thermal generators of atomic fluorine.
